Multi-function tools are very flexible power tools designed for use in smaller-scale work and projects. Multi-function power tools use an oscillating (or side-to-side) motion to perform tasks such as routing, cutting, sawing, scraping and sanding. The functions of a multi-function tool are dependant on the tool, and the accessories available for it. The accessories for the specific multi-function tool also affect the materials it can be used with, but this may include use on copper, plastics, wood, stone, metals and more.

  • Choosing your power source: The first choice is between a mains (110v or 240v) or a cordless tool. 240v tools are used with normal mains power whilst 110v tools are used on construction sites for safety reasons.
  • With regards to cordless (battery powered) tools there are a variety of chemical types; Li-ion is the latest technology, prior to that it was Ni-MH and Ni-Cad was the original. The higher the Ah (Ampere hours) the longer the interval between charges; the fewer times you recharge a battery the longer it will last. Some cordless tools can also come without batteries - sometimes referred to as naked, bare units or body only. These tools are supplied without a battery or charger and more often than not without any accessories; as a result they are significantly cheaper in price.
